home *** CD-ROM | disk | FTP | other *** search
/ rtsi.com / 2014.01.www.rtsi.com.tar / www.rtsi.com / OS9 / OSK / APPS / hl10osrc.lzh / Lib / makefile.msdos < prev    next >
Makefile  |  1994-04-23  |  2KB  |  71 lines

  1. CPP = gcc
  2. DEBUG = -g
  3. CFLAGS = $(DEBUG) -I../Include -I/djgpp/contrib/windows/inc -c -DMESSYDOS
  4.  
  5. SRCS = vbtee.cc vm.cc cardrec.cc listrec.cc cmdscren.cc \
  6.     editform.cc scrpmt.cc llscrpmt.cc terminal.cc \
  7.     prsexp.y evalexpr.cc card.cc ptree.cc llist.cc
  8.  
  9. OBJS = vbtree.o vm.o cardrec.o listrec.o cmdscren.o \
  10.     editform.o scrpmt.o llscrpmt.o terminal.o \
  11.     prsexp.o evalexpr.o card.o ptree.o llist.o
  12.  
  13. LIBR = liblib.a
  14.  
  15. $(LIBR) : $(OBJS)
  16.     ar rv $(LIBR) $(OBJS)
  17.     ranlib $(LIBR)
  18.  
  19. vm.o : vm.cc ../Include/common.h ../Include/vm.h
  20.     $(CPP) $(CFLAGS) vm.cc -o vm.o
  21.  
  22. vbtree.o : vbtree.cc ../include/common.h ../include/vm.h ../include/vbtree.h
  23.     $(CPP) $(CFLAGS) vbtree.cc -o vbtree.o
  24.  
  25. cardrec.o : cardrec.cc ../Include/common.h ../Include/card.h \
  26.         ../Include/cardrec.h
  27.     $(CPP) $(CFLAGS) cardrec.cc -o cardrec.o
  28.  
  29. listrec.o : listrec.cc ../Include/common.h ../Include/listrec.h
  30.     $(CPP) $(CFLAGS) listrec.cc -o listrec.o
  31.  
  32. card.o : card.cc ../Include/common.h ../Include/card.h
  33.     $(CPP) $(CFLAGS) card.cc -o card.o
  34.  
  35. llist.o : llist.cc ../Include/common.h ../Include/llist.h
  36.     $(CPP) $(CFLAGS) llist.cc -o llist.o
  37.  
  38. ptree.o : ptree.cc ../Include/common.h ../Include/ptree.h
  39.     $(CPP) $(CFLAGS) ptree.cc -o ptree.o
  40.  
  41. terminal.o : terminal.cc ../Include/common.h ../Include/terminal.h
  42.     $(CPP) $(CFLAGS) terminal.cc -o terminal.o
  43.  
  44. cmdscren.o : cmdscren.cc ../Include/common.h ../Include/terminal.h \
  45.         ../Include/cmdscren.h
  46.     $(CPP) $(CFLAGS) cmdscren.cc -o cmdscren.o
  47.  
  48. editform.o : editform.cc ../Include/common.h ../Include/terminal.h \
  49.         ../Include/editform.h
  50.     $(CPP) $(CFLAGS) editform.cc -o editform.o
  51.  
  52. scrpmt.o : scrpmt.cc ../Include/common.h ../Include/Terminal.h \
  53.         ../Include/scrpmt.h
  54.     $(CPP) $(CFLAGS) scrpmt.cc -o scrpmt.o
  55.  
  56. llscrpmt.o : llscrpmt.cc ../Include/common.h ../Include/terminal.h \
  57.         ../Include/llscrpmt.h ../Include/llist.h
  58.     $(CPP) $(CFLAGS) llscrpmt.cc -o llscrpmt.o
  59.  
  60. prsexp.o : prsexptb.cc ../Include/common.h ../Include/card.h \
  61.           ../Include/ptree.h
  62.     $(CPP) $(CFLAGS) -DYYDEBUG=1 prsexptb.cc -o prsexp.o
  63.  
  64. evalexpr.o : evalexpr.cc ../Include/common.h ../Include/card.h \
  65.           ../Include/ptree.h
  66.     $(CPP) $(CFLAGS) evalexpr.cc -o evalexpr.o
  67.  
  68. #prsexptb.cc : prsexp.y
  69. #    bisonpp -vd prsexp.y
  70.  
  71.